Graduate Student, Lacy-Hulbert Lab; Center for Systems Immunology

Kayla is a graduate student in the UW immunology program. She got her BS in microbiology from UMass Amherst in 2012 and then worked as a research technician and lab manager at UC San Francisco in Dr. Mark Anderson’s lab studying mechanisms of central T cell tolerance. She then moved into the biotech industry, working in pharmacology/toxicology and discovery immunology until deciding to pursue her PhD. Kayla joined the Lacy-Hulbert lab in 2021 and is studying trained immune responses in human macrophages. In her freetime, Kayla is an avid scuba diver who is always looking for her next dive trip.
